Abstract
In order to support various requirements from the user’s perspective, digital library (DL) systems may need to apply a large variety of services, such as query services for a specific DL, mapping services for mapping and integrating heterogeneous metadata records, or query modification and expansion services for retrieving additional relevant documents. This paper focuses on exploiting an extended Service-Oriented Architecture – Peer-based SOA (PSOA) for DL development with the goal of alleviating the weaknesses in the basic SOA infrastructure, especially in the aspects of scalability and interoperability. We also present our work in how to combine the Semantic Web and Web Services together to support interoperability over heterogeneous library services. A query service example is also presented.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Preview
Unable to display preview. Download preview PDF.
References
Booth, D., Haas, H., et al.: Web services architecture. W3CWorking Group Note, Web Services Architecture (2004), http://www.w3.org/TR/ws-arch/
Papazoglou, M.P.: Service -oriented computing: Concepts, characteristics and directions. In: Fourth International Conference on Web Information Systems Engineering, WISE 2003 (2003)
Chappell, D.A., Jewell, T.: Java Web Services. O’Reilly, USA (2002)
Hunter, J., Choudhury, S.: A semi-automated digital preservation system based on semantic web services. In: Joint Conferece on Digitial Libraries, Tucson, Arizona, USA, pp. 269–278 (2004)
Anan, H., Tang, J., Maly, K., Nelson, M., Zubair, M., Yang, Z.: Challenges in building federation services over harvested metadata. In: International Conference on Asian Digital Libraries (ICADL), Kuala Lumpur, Malaysia, pp. 602–614 (2003)
Nottelmann, H., Fuhr, N.: Combining daml+oil, xslt, and probabilistic logics for uncertain schema mappings in mind. In: European Conference on Digital Libraries (ECDL), Trondheim, Norway, pp. 194–206 (2003)
Dublin core medata initiative (2003), http://www.dublincore.org
Encoded archival description: Official ead. Version, web site (Last Visit: September 15, 2002), http://www.loc.gov/ead/
Draft standard for learning object metadata (Last visit: September 15, 2002), http://ltsc.ieee.org/wg12/
Marc standards (n.d.). library of congress network development and marc standards office (Last visit: September 15, 2004), http://lcweb.loc.gov/marc/
Editeur: Onix international (n.d.). release 1.2 (Last visit: September 15, 2004), http://www.editeur.org/onix_les1.2/onix_les.html
Godby, C.J., Smith, D., Childress, E.: Two paths to interoperable metadata. In: DublinCore Conference, DC-2003: Supporting Communities of Discourse and Practice Metadata Research & Applications, Seattle,Washington, USA (2003)
Metadata switch: schema transformation services. a project of oclc research (Last visit: September 15, 2002), http://www.oclc.org/research/projects/mswitch/1schematrans.shtm
Sycara, K., Paolucci, M., Lewis, M.: Information discovery and fusion: Semantics on the battle_eld. In: Proceedings of the Sixth International Conference of Information Fusion, vol. 1, pp. 538–544 (2003)
Ding, H., Solvberg, I.: Towards the schema heterogeneity in distributed digital libraries. In: 6th International Conference on Enterprise Information System (ICEIS), Porto, Portugal, vol. 5 (2004)
Ding, H., Solvberg, I.: A schema integration framework over super-peer based network. In: 2004 IEEE International Conference on Services Computing (SCC 2004), Wuhan, China (2004) (Special Session)
Sagan, H.: Space-Filling Curves. Springer-Verlag Telos (1994)
Paolucci, M., Sycara, K.: Autonomous semantic web services. IEEE, Internet Computing, 34–42 (2003)
Members., D.S.C.: Owl-s 1.0 release (2003) (Last visit: September 15, 2004), http://www.daml.org/services/owl-s/1.0/
Sycara, K.: Dynamic discovery, invocation and composition of semantic web services. In: Hellenic Conference on Arti_cial Intelligence (SETN), pp. 3–12 (2004)
Gudgin, M., Hadley, M., et al.: Soap version 1.2, w3c recommendation (2003) (Last visit: September 15, 2004), http://www.w3.org/TR/soap12-part1/
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2004 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Ding, H., Sølvberg, I. (2004). Exploiting Extended Service-Oriented Architecture for Federated Digital Libraries. In: Chen, Z., Chen, H., Miao, Q., Fu, Y., Fox, E., Lim, Ep. (eds) Digital Libraries: International Collaboration and Cross-Fertilization. ICADL 2004. Lecture Notes in Computer Science, vol 3334.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-540-30544-6_19
Download citation
DOI: https://doi.org/10.1007/978-3-540-30544-6_19
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-540-24030-3
Online ISBN: 978-3-540-30544-6
eBook Packages: Computer ScienceComputer Science (R0)